The Radical Innovation Playbook is a practical guide that helps innovators and entrepreneurs to harness new, extreme ideas despite complex business barriers along the way.
Designed to be easy-to-use The Radical Innovation Playbook provides insight, practical solutions and reusable canvasses to help innovation managers, CEOs, Chief Innovators and directors of innovation labs to develop breakthrough ideas.
In this playbook you will learn how to:
- Make vital decisions about how to plan and share your radical ideas
- Collect and analyse information to influence and convince others
- Engage with peers and stakeholders about your innovation project
- Challenge established company norms and business models
- Discover, explore and secure investment
- Gain confidence and skills for a successful launch
- Reach new markets and commercial channels
- Build a structure within an organisation that enables innovation to grow
- Inspire and support future generations to make an impact and achieve success
